Licensing and Responsible Gaming

Jackpot Bingo holds a licence from the UK Gambling Commission. This isn’t just a logo on the website. It means they have to adhere to strict rules on integrity, protecting player money, and preventing problem gambling. You can check the licence details simply in the app’s footer. They employ standard SSL encryption to secure your data, so your personal and payment details are safeguarded. For a daily user, this regulated environment is the bedrock. It lets you relax and savor the games, knowing there’s a serious watchdog on duty.

The app also places responsible gambling tools at the forefront in your account settings. You can configure da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limits. You can enable session reminders to inform you how long you’ve been playing. There are options to take a short break (a time-out) or to self-exclude for longer. Links to organisations are supplied. Being able to manage these controls yourself, directly from your phone, puts you in charge. It’s a essential and appreciated part of any modern gambling app, permitting you to set your own lines around your play.

How quickly are withdrawals handled on the Jackpot Bingo app?

The processing time depends on your chosen withdrawal method. E-wallet payouts, including PayPal, typically process within 24 hours. Withdrawals back to a debit card or by bank transfer usually take between 2 and 5 working days. The app provides an estimated time, and all withdrawals undergo standard security checks.
